Tall Can Sports 121: Opening Day

The boys tee up the Blue Jays as they prepare to finish their exhibition season with 2 games at the Big O in Montreal and kick off the regular season in Baltimore on Monday. 

Is there any reason to continue having this mini-series in Montreal and is there any chance of the city getting an MLB team in the foreseeable future?

The Jays have set their pitching rotation and it shapes up pretty well. Find out what the guys think and what the reasoning behind the set up is. 

And maybe even some talk about Rob's childhood including the fact that he at one point had a home made winter coat....